The Wild Robot Film – Family Review

We recently finished reading The Wild Robot by Peter Brown at bedtime—and absolutely loved it. So naturally, we were thrilled to discover there’s a film based on the book too!

Can You Watch the Film Without Reading the Book?

Absolutely. If you haven’t read the book, you can still enjoy the film on its own. That said, if you have read the book, you’ll get a lot more out of some of the emotional moments and background detail (plus we always love a good book-to-screen comparison!).

The storyline follows a robot named Roz who finds herself stranded on an island and has to learn to survive. At first, the island’s animals are terrified of her and believe she’s a monster. But after adopting an orphaned gosling and helping various animals in need, Roz slowly earns their trust. There are so many adventures, twists, and emotional moments—it’s a brilliant, heartfelt story.

What We Thought of the Film

As with most book adaptations, the storyline doesn’t stick exactly to the book—but we actually loved the way the film began. While the book has a slower, more thoughtful start, the film jumps straight into action with stunning visuals and a storyline that had us hooked from the beginning.

And where the book leans more into emotion and friendship, the film brings the laughs! Within ten minutes, my 10-year-old son and I were laughing out loud—especially during the scene where a possum mum tries to explain motherhood to Roz the robot. That bit was genius.

Our Verdict

We really, really loved this film! It’s definitely an emotional rollercoaster—there are a few teary moments—but overall it’s a feel-good family movie that left us smiling.
